Manuscript

Chemist's recipe book

Date: 1869

From: Turner, Donald Langley, fl 1869-1898 : Papers

Reference: MS-2188

Description: Volume includes an index and pharmaceutical recipes for medical cures as well as directions on how to make household items like black ink, furniture cream, and toilet vinegar. Also notes of a general nature, newspaper cuttings, and advertising labels. One example is a pharmaceutical label in Māori for a cough mixture "Te Ringita o Tapu - He Rongoa Mare Mare" (page 93). Volume includes a brass clasp and examples of wax seals on the front and rear covers. Arrangement: MS-2188-2189 are boxed together Quantity: 1 volume(s).
